Mining Incidents
Fatality · MSHA Record #219920930001

Assayer

March 19, 1992 at 10:20 AM
Blacksville #1 · Facility · Coal
Monongalia County, WV
Classification IGNITION OR EXPLOSION OF GAS OR DUST
Type Struck by flying object
Investigator narrative
VICTIM WAS AT A CONSTRUCITON SITE WHERE CONTRACTORS WERE WORKING AT THE TOP OF A PRODUCTION SHAFT WHEN AN EXPLOSION OCCURRED CAUSING HIS DEATH
Record details
Activity at time of incident
Supervise
Subunit / location
SURFACE AT UNDERGROUND
Accident type
Struck by flying object
Source of injury
CAVING ROCK,COAL,ORE,WSTE
Nature of injury
MULTIPLE INJURIES
Body part affected
MULTIPLE PARTS (MORE THAN ONE MAJOR)
Total mining experience
15 years
Experience in this job
10 years
Degree of injury
FATALITY
